Knowledge of the Offshore Support Vessels (OSVs)
Offshore Support Vessels are special marine ships that have been developed to support offshore operations. The most frequent types of vessels are platform supply vessels, anchor handling vessels, and multipurpose support vessels. The types support certain operational needs, including, but not limited to, logistics support, towing, positioning, and subsea assistance.
The demand at the offshore vessel market is dependent on the oil prices, the demand of offshore projects, the regulations, and the availability of the vessels. This means that the sale and acquisition of OSVs must be well planned and understood in the market.

Advantages of Professional Offshore Vessel Brokerage
The use of established offshore vessel brokers provides access to international customers and sellers of vessels, market intelligence, and organized transaction patterns. The services of a broker assist in minimizing the risks, enhancing the pricing performance, and facilitating the timely process of a deal.
Contract negotiations, technical coordination, and compliance checks are also effectively conducted with the help of professional brokerage, which makes the process of buying and selling quite effective and safe.
Offshore Support Vessels in the Emerging Energy Markets
Emerging energy markets are also increasing the demand for offshore support vessels, especially where offshore exploration and energy infrastructure are being invested. These markets are also an avenue for buyers who want to get cheap vessels and sellers who want to venture into new markets.
Recycled and refurbished OSVs have become more popular in offshore developments in developing energy markets as a compromise between quality and cost.
Sustainability and Reuse of Assets
Purchasing and selling of offshore support vessels also help in the sustainability initiative as it prolongs the operational life of the already available marine resources. Reusing vessels would lower the environmental cost linked with the construction of new vessels and enhance the responsible management of marine resources.
